42 Most Wanted Persons Nabbed in 24-Hour CALABARZON Police Operation

Police Regional Office 4A (CALABARZON) arrested 42 wanted individuals in a regionwide law enforcement blitz carried out within a 24-hour period.

The simultaneous operations were conducted by various police units across CALABARZON on July 28, leading to the apprehension of eight Most Wanted Persons (MWPs) and 34 other wanted individuals.

Of the eight MWPs, four were listed at the regional level, while others were classified as most wanted at the provincial, city, and municipal levels.

Among those arrested was an individual identified only as alias Marc, who was wanted for violations of Republic Act 9165, or the Comprehensive Dangerous Drugs Act of 2002. He was apprehended at around 1:07 p.m. in Barangay Bigaa, Cabuyao City, Laguna, by personnel from the Cabuyao City Police Station and the 402nd A Maneuver Company of the Regional Mobile Force Battalion 4A.

In Cavite, two suspects with multiple rape charges were arrested in separate operations. Alias Edward, facing four counts of rape, was arrested at around 2:05 p.m. in Barangay Amaya 6, Tanza. Roughly an hour later, alias Virgilio, also with four rape cases, was apprehended in Barangay Julugan 1, Tanza. Both operations were carried out by the Tanza Municipal Police Station.

Meanwhile, alias Jomel, another suspect in a rape case, was captured at 2:52 p.m. in Barangay Olo-olo, Lobo, Batangas, in a joint operation led by the Lobo Municipal Police Station, the 4th Maneuver Platoon of the 1st Batangas Provincial Mobile Force Company, and the Regional Intelligence Unit 4A.

Brig. Gen. Jack L. Wanky, Regional Director of PRO CALABARZON, lauded the successful operations, calling them a clear demonstration of the police’s commitment to justice and public safety.

“No one can escape the law. Each arrest proves our resolve to deliver justice and protect our communities,” Wanky said in a statement.

He added that the success of the operation was the result of effective intelligence work, coordinated police action, and strong community support.

“PRO CALABARZON will continue to implement sustained efforts to ensure peace and order across the region,” he added.

The operations are part of ongoing intensified efforts under the Philippine National Police’s anti-criminality campaign.
